Attractions and Places To See around Toril Y Masegoso - Top 20

Best attractions and places to see around Toril Y Masegoso, a municipality in the Sierra de Albarracín, offers a blend of natural beauty and cultural heritage. The area is characterized by pristine nature, including pine forests and juniper groves, and traditional architecture. Significant portions of the municipality are within Sites of Community Importance, highlighting its valuable natural heritage. Visitors can explore various natural features, cultural sites, and hiking routes.

December 7, 2024, Cascada de la Herrería

The Cascada de la Herrería is a natural gem located in the Sierra de Albarracín, near the town of El Vallecillo. This beautiful waterfall, also known as the “Hidden Waterfall,” has a drop of approximately 8 meters over the Cabriel River. To reach the waterfall, you can follow a hiking route that begins in El Vallecillo. The route is short, just half a kilometer, and takes you through a varied and picturesque landscape. During the walk, you will also be able to see the natural springs known as the Ojos del Cabriel, which feed the river and the waterfall.

We are in Alto de la Cruz, also known as Peña Botadera, it was a strategic place during the Civil War. It is located at an altitude of 1,535 meters and has a viewpoint that offers spectacular views. Nearby there are old trenches from the war, the beautiful Laguna de Bezas and/or various fountains and viewpoints.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ural features can I explore around Toril y Masegoso?

The region is rich in natural beauty, particularly known for its stunning waterfalls and river systems. You can visit the impressive Herrería Waterfall, also known as the "Hidden Waterfall," or the picturesque San Pedro Mill Waterfall, which features a pool popular for swimming. Don't miss the Calicanto Waterfall, a 15-meter high cascade. The area also boasts the natural springs of Ojos del Cabriel, which feed the Cabriel River, and extensive Scots pine forests and juniper groves.

Are there any historical or cultural sites to visit in Toril y Masegoso?

Yes, the villages of Toril and Masegoso offer cultural insights. In Toril, you can see the Iglesia de los Santos Abdón y Senén, a church believed to have originated from a 17th-century hermitage. Masegoso features the Iglesia de Nuestra Señora del Remedio, which became a parish church in the early 18th century. Additionally, the Alto de la Cruz (Peña Botadera) Lookout, while primarily a viewpoint, also holds historical significance with old trenches from the Civil War nearby.

What kind of hiking trails are available near Toril y Masegoso?

The area is excellent for hiking, with trails catering to various levels. The GR10.1 trail traverses the municipality, offering a great way to discover its natural heritage. You can also find routes leading to natural springs like Ojos del Cabriel and waterfalls such as Herrería Waterfall. Are there family-friendly activities or attractions in the area?

Many of the natural attractions are suitable for families. The short hiking route to the Herrería Waterfall is considered family-friendly, as are the paths leading to Ojos del Cabriel. The Calicanto Waterfall is also noted as ideal for families, especially in summer, due to its spectacular setting and easy access.

Where can I find panoramic views around Toril y Masegoso?

For breathtaking panoramic views, head to the Alto de la Cruz (Peña Botadera) Lookout. Situated at an altitude of 1,535 meters, it offers spectacular 360° vistas of the surrounding forests and landscape. Another recommended spot is the Mirador del Puntal del Rayo, a viewpoint at 1,689 meters altitude, accessible via a walk from the GR10.1 trail.

Can I go wild swimming near Toril y Masegoso?

Yes, the San Pedro Mill Waterfall is known for its beautiful pool, which is popular for swimming in summer. It's advisable to wear swimming or canyoning shoes due to the porous stones in the water. The view from behind the waterfall is also a unique experience.

What is the best time of year to visit Toril y Masegoso?

The natural attractions, especially the waterfalls and swimming spots, are particularly enjoyable during the warmer months, typically summer, when the pools are popular for bathing. However, the hiking trails and viewpoints offer beautiful scenery throughout the year, with autumn providing vibrant foliage and spring showcasing lush greenery.

Are there any dog-friendly trails or attractions?

While specific dog-friendly designations are not always explicit, many natural trails in the Sierra de Albarracín, including those leading to waterfalls and viewpoints, are generally suitable for well-behaved dogs on a leash. Always ensure to follow local regulations and clean up after your pet.

What local gastronomy can I experience in Toril y Masegoso?

The area's gastronomy highlights high-quality local products. You can savor specialties such as Teruel Ham and Ternasco de Aragón (Aragonese lamb), alongside various game meats. These reflect the rich traditional cuisine of the region, offering a taste of authentic local flavors.

Are there any hidden gems or less-known spots to discover?

Beyond the main attractions, the region is dotted with numerous natural springs like Fuente del Prado and Fuente Vieja, which offer tranquil spots. The Herrería Waterfall is also known as the "Hidden Waterfall," suggesting a more secluded feel. Exploring the various paths within the LIC Valdecabriel-Las Tejeras and LIC Cuenca del Ebrón can lead to serene and less-trafficked natural areas.
